Facts of the Matter: Magnets unreliable aides Jun 2, 2008
There has been no good scientific research that validates magnet therapy, though there has been the occasional positive study ... The benefits of magnet therapy may not be due to the magnets themselves ... The National Institute for Health (NIH), after a review of the worldwide scientific literature regarding magnet therapy wrote: " . . . the scientific evidence to support the success of this therapy is lacking. More scientifically sound studies are needed in order to fully understand the... (Honolulu Star-Bulletin)
